Q. The number of linkage groups present in a diploid animal is

Solution:

The tendency of genes present on the same chromosome to be inherited together is called linkage. All the genes on a chromosome are said to be linked to one another and belong to the same linkage group. Number of linkage groups of a particular species corresponds to its haploid number of chromosomes or number of pairs of chromosomes. E.g. Pisum has 14 chromosomes thus it has seven linkage groups.
